Output 81c8dfa234543d8f56ba81eaa0100cee075dd4d85a4d9f1dfe65d1aaf6899aa6:0

value
735270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c41901b4f54289b2623db3e22523c56df8d95d37 OP_EQUAL
address
3KZtKdrXvrq44ertgFozBQubxAKDftYcLB
transaction
81c8dfa234543d8f56ba81eaa0100cee075dd4d85a4d9f1dfe65d1aaf6899aa6
spent
true